Much of what was once taken for granted as part of democracy seems to have been abolished. We no longer know what to believe to be true. The false glamor of conservative hopeful Sebastian Kurz, for example, quickly dissolved in a cloud of scandals, corruption and dubious entourage. But while the multiple crises completely unsettle the public, Kurz effortlessly finds a connection with Donald Trump’s supporters, who would prefer to throw our political system overboard immediately. In his new book, Armin Thurnher probes the situation and shows that, as always, the great end of the world is holding its little dress rehearsal in Austria.

Armin Thurnher is co-founder, publisher and editor-in-chief of the Viennese city newspaper Falter. He has received many awards, including the Austrian Book Trade Prize for Tolerance and the Otto Brenner Prize for his commitment to a social Europe.
